ADMINISTRATOR'S SALE.

On Saturday the 13th day of August next,
There will be offered for sale at the late residence of Jonathan Clark, dec'd, five miles east of Lebanon, all the personal estate of Jonathan Clark, deceased, to wit:
HORSES, CATTLE, SHEEP, HOGS,
One Horse WAGGON & HARNESS,
CORN on the ground, WHEAT in the Stack,
BEDS and BEDDING,
HOUSEHOLD & KITCHEN FURNITURE;
And FARMING UTENSILS.

A liberal credit will be given on all sums over two dollars, on good security being given. -
Sale to commence at 10 o'clock on said day where terms will be made known.
JEREMIAH SMITH, Admr.
August 28, 1828

Source: The Western Star, Lebanon Ohio, Saturday August 30, 1828, [copy obtained from microfilm available at the Warren County Genealogical Society]
